--- title: "Online banking Poland Android Component" description: "Add Online banking Poland to your Components integration." url: "https://docs.adyen.com/payment-methods/online-banking-poland/android-component" source_url: "https://docs.adyen.com/payment-methods/online-banking-poland/android-component.md" canonical: "https://docs.adyen.com/payment-methods/online-banking-poland/android-component" last_modified: "2026-05-24T12:54:31+02:00" language: "en" --- # Online banking Poland Android Component Add Online banking Poland to your Components integration. [View source](/payment-methods/online-banking-poland/android-component.md) You can add Online banking Poland to your existing integration. The following instructions show only what you must add to your integration specifically for Online banking Poland. If an instruction on this page corresponds with a step in the main integration guide, it includes a link to corresponding step of the main integration guide. The additions you must make depends on the [server-side flow](/online-payments/build-your-integration) that your integration uses: ## Sessions flow Component ### Before-You-Begin ## Requirements | Requirement | Description | | | --------------------- | 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| - | | **Integration type** | Make sure that you have an existing Sessions flow [Android Components integration](/online-payments/build-your-integration/sessions-flow?platform=Android). | | | **Checkout API** | Make sure that you use Checkout API v68 or later. | | | **Redirect handling** | Make sure that your existing integration is set up to [handle the redirect](/online-payments/build-your-integration/sessions-flow?platform=Android\&integration=Components#handle-the-redirect). `action.type`: **redirect** | | | **Setup steps** | Before you begin, [add Online banking Poland in your Customer Area](/payment-methods/add-payment-methods). | | ### Add-Parameters-Sessions-Request ## Add additional parameters to your /sessions request When you [create a payment session](/online-payments/build-your-integration/sessions-flow?platform=Android\&integration=Components#create-a-payment-session), add the following parameters: | Parameter | Required | Description | |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| ----------------------------------------------------------- | | [shopperEmail](https://docs.adyen.com/api-explorer/Checkout/latest/post/sessions#request-shopperEmail) | ![-white\_check\_mark-](/user/data/smileys/emoji/white_check_mark.png "-white_check_mark-") | The shopper's email address. Must be 50 or less characters. | **Example /sessions request** #### curl ```bash curl https://checkout-test.adyen.com/v71/sessions \ -H 'x-API-key: ADYEN_API_KEY' \ -H 'Idempotency-Key: YOUR_IDEMPOTENCY_KEY' \ -H 'content-type: application/json' \ -X POST -d '{ "merchantAccount": "ADYEN_MERCHANT_ACCOUNT", "amount": { "value": 1000, "currency": "PLN" }, "returnUrl": "adyencheckout://your.package.name", "reference": "YOUR_PAYMENT_REFERENCE", "countryCode": "PL", "shopperEmail": "s.hopper@example.com" }' ``` #### Java ```java // Adyen Java API Library v40.0.0 import com.adyen.Client; import com.adyen.enums.Environment; import com.adyen.model.checkout.*; import java.time.OffsetDateTime; import java.util.*; import com.adyen.model.RequestOptions; import com.adyen.service.checkout.*; // For the LIVE environment, also include your liveEndpointUrlPrefix. const response = checkoutAPI.PaymentsApi.sessions(createCheckoutSessionRequest, { idempotencyKey: "UUID" }); ``` ### Import-Component ## Import the Component for Online banking Poland To [import the library](/online-payments/build-your-integration/sessions-flow?platform=Android\&integration=Components#import) and include the module for Online banking Poland. ### Tab: With Jetpack Compose **Import the module with Compose** ```java implementation "com.adyen.checkout:onlinebankingpl:YOUR_VERSION" implementation "com.adyen.checkout:components-compose:YOUR_VERSION" ``` ### Tab: Without Jetpack Compose **Import the module without Compose** ```java implementation "com.adyen.checkout:onlinebankingpl:YOUR_VERSION" ``` ### Add-Configuration ## Add additional configuration for Online banking Poland [Add a configuration object](/online-payments/build-your-integration/sessions-flow?platform=Android\&integration=Components#3-optional-add-a-configuration-object) with the following parameters: | Parameter | Required | Description | | ---------------------- | -------- | -------------------------------------------------------------------- | | setSubmitButtonVisible | | Set to **false** to hide the submit button. The default is **true**. | **Add a configuration object** ```kotlin { .setSubmitButtonVisible(value) } ``` ### Launch-And-Show ## Launch and show the Component for Online banking Poland To [create the Component](/online-payments/build-your-integration/sessions-flow?platform=Android\&integration=Components#launch-and-show) for Online banking Poland, use the `OnlineBankingPLComponent` class. ### Tab: With Jetpack Compose **Launch and show the Component** ```kotlin import com.adyen.checkout.components.compose.get // Get the payment method. val paymentMethod = checkoutSession.getPaymentMethod(PaymentMethodTypes.SCHEME) @Composable private fun ComposableOnlineBankingPLComponent() { // Keep a reference to this Component in case you need to access it later. val onlinebankingplComponent = OnlineBankingPLComponent.PROVIDER.get( checkoutSession = checkoutSession, paymentMethod = paymentMethod, configuration = checkoutConfiguration, componentCallback = callback, // This key is required to ensure a new Component gets created for each different screen or payment session. // Generate a new value for this key every time you need to reset the Component. key = "YOUR_UNIQUE_KEY_FOR_THIS_COMPONENT", ) // This is your composable, a wrapper around our xml view. AdyenComponent( component = onlinebankingplComponent, modifier = YOUR_MODIFIER, ) } ``` ### Tab: Without Jetpack Compose ```kotlin // Get the payment method. val paymentMethod = checkoutSession.getPaymentMethod(PaymentMethodTypes.SCHEME) val onlinebankingplComponent = OnlineBankingPLComponent.PROVIDER.get( activity, // Your activity or fragment. checkoutSession, paymentMethod, checkoutConfiguration, componentCallback ) // Attach the Component to your view. binding.onlinebankingplView.attach(onlinebankingplComponent, activity) // Your activity or fragment. ``` ## Test and go live Check the status of Online banking Poland test payments in your [Customer Area](https://ca-test.adyen.com/) > **Transactions** > **Payments**. Before you can accept live Online banking Poland payments, you need to [submit a request for Online banking Poland](/payment-methods/add-payment-methods) in your [live Customer Area](https://ca-live.adyen.com/). ## Advanced flow Component ## Requirements | Requirement | Description | | | -------------------- | --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| - | | **Integration type** | Make sure that you have an existing Advanced flow [Android Components integration](/online-payments/build-your-integration/advanced-flow?platform=Android). | | | **Action handling** | Make sure that your existing integration is set up to [handle the additional action](/online-payments/build-your-integration/advanced-flow/?platform=Android\&integration=Components#additional-action). `action.type`: redirect. | | | **Setup steps** | Before you begin, [add Online banking Poland in your Customer Area](/payment-methods/add-payment-methods). | | ### Import ## Import the Component for Online banking Poland To [import the library](/online-payments/build-your-integration/advanced-flow/?platform=Android\&integration=Components#import) and include the module for Online banking Poland. ### Tab: With Jetpack Compose **Import the module with Compose** ```java implementation "com.adyen.checkout:onlinebankingpl:YOUR_VERSION" implementation "com.adyen.checkout:components-compose:YOUR_VERSION" ``` ### Tab: Without Jetpack Compose **Import the module without Compose** ```java implementation "com.adyen.checkout:onlinebankingpl:YOUR_VERSION" ``` ### Add Configuration ## Add additional configuration for Online banking Poland [Add a configuration object](/online-payments/build-your-integration/advanced-flow/?platform=Android\&integration=Components#3-optional-add-a-configuration-object) with the following parameters: | Parameter | Required | Description | | ---------------------- | -------- | -------------------------------------------------------------------- | | setSubmitButtonVisible | | Set to **false** to hide the submit button. The default is **true**. | **Add a configuration object** ```kotlin { .setSubmitButtonVisible(value) } ``` ### Launch And Show ## Launch and show the Component for Online banking Poland To [create the Component](/online-payments/build-your-integration/advanced-flow/?platform=Android\&integration=Components#launch-and-show) for Online banking Poland, use the `OnlineBankingPLComponent` class. ### Tab: With Jetpack Compose **Launch and show the Component** ```kotlin import com.adyen.checkout.components.compose.get // Create the payment method object from the /paymentMethods response. val paymentMethod = paymentMethodsApiResponse?.paymentMethods.orEmpty().firstOrNull { it.type == PaymentMethodTypes.SCHEME } @Composable private fun ComposableOnlineBankingPLComponent() { // Keep a reference to this Component in case you need to access it later. val onlinebankingplComponent = OnlineBankingPLComponent.PROVIDER.get( paymentMethod = paymentMethod, configuration = checkoutConfiguration, componentCallback = callback, // This key is required to ensure a new Component gets created for each different screen or payment session. // Generate a new value for this key every time you need to reset the Component. key = "UNIQUE_KEY_PER_COMPONENT", ) // This is your composable, a wrapper around our xml view. AdyenComponent( component = onlinebankingplComponent, modifier = YOUR_MODIFIER, ) } ``` ### Tab: Without Jetpack Compose ```kotlin // Create the payment method object from the /paymentMethods response. val paymentMethod = paymentMethodsApiResponse?.paymentMethods.orEmpty().firstOrNull { it.type == PaymentMethodTypes.SCHEME } val onlinebankingplComponent = OnlineBankingPLComponent.PROVIDER.get( activity, // Your activity or fragment. paymentMethod, checkoutConfiguration, componentCallback, ) //Attach the Component to your view. binding.onlinebankingplView.attach(onlinebankingplComponent, activity) // Your activity or fragment. ``` ### Add Parameters Payments Request ## Add additional parameters to your /payments request When you [make a payment](/online-payments/build-your-integration/advanced-flow/?platform=Android\&integration=Components#make-a-payment), add the following parameters to the [/payments](https://docs.adyen.com/api-explorer/Checkout/latest/post/payments) request: | Parameter | Required | Description | |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| ----------------------------------------------------------- | | [shopperEmail](https://docs.adyen.com/api-explorer/Checkout/latest/post/payments#request-shopperEmail) | ![-white\_check\_mark-](/user/data/smileys/emoji/white_check_mark.png "-white_check_mark-") | The shopper's email address. Must be 50 or less characters. | | `paymentMethod.issuer` | | The issuer ID of the shopper's selected bank. | **Example payment request for Online banking Poland** #### curl ```bash curl https://checkout-test.adyen.com/v72/payments \ -H 'x-API-key: ADYEN_API_KEY' \ -H 'idempotency-key: YOUR_IDEMPOTENCY_KEY' \ -H 'content-type: application/json' \ -X POST -d '{ "amount":{ "currency":"PLN", "value":1000 }, "reference":"YOUR_ORDER_NUMBER", "paymentMethod":{ "type":"onlineBanking_PL", "issuer":"141" }, "returnUrl":"https://your-company.com/checkout?shopperOrder=12xy..", "merchantAccount":"ADYEN_MERCHANT_ACCOUNT", "shopperEmail":"s.hopper@example.com" }' ``` #### Java ```java // Adyen Java API Library v40.0.0 import com.adyen.Client; import com.adyen.enums.Environment; import com.adyen.model.checkout.*; import java.time.OffsetDateTime; import java.util.*; import com.adyen.model.RequestOptions; import com.adyen.service.checkout.*; // For the LIVE environment, also include your liveEndpointUrlPrefix. // Send the request const checkoutAPI = new CheckoutAPI(client); const response = checkoutAPI.PaymentsApi.payments(paymentRequest, { idempotencyKey: "UUID" }); ``` The response includes `action.type`: **redirect**. **Example response with a redirect action** ```json { "resultCode":"RedirectShopper", "action":{ "paymentMethodType":"onlineBanking_PL", "method":"GET", "url":"https://checkoutshopper-test.adyen.com/checkoutshopper/checkoutPaymentRedirect?redirectData=...", "type":"redirect" } } ``` ## Test and go live Check the status of Online banking Poland test payments in your [Customer Area](https://ca-test.adyen.com/) > **Transactions** > **Payments**. Before you can accept live Online banking Poland payments, you need to [submit a request for Online banking Poland](/payment-methods/add-payment-methods) in your [live Customer Area](https://ca-live.adyen.com/).
